I trained as a Davis® Facilitator after my youngest son had received a Davis programme. He had been struggling at school, particularly with maths, and seemed to be overlooked because he could read and was not ‘bad enough’ in either his academic achievement or behaviour. I researched different ‘options’ until someone told me about the book ‘The Gift of Dyslexia’. It was a revelation to me: it helped me understand how my son thinks and explained why he was experiencing difficulties.
I feel privileged to work with such interesting and diverse thinkers. A Davis programme often opens up their world – interesting feed-back includes a 17 year old catching a tennis ball for the first time in her life and a 9 year old who didn’t need to say pardon any more when he was on the phone to his granddad. A 50 year old client told me, midway through her programme, that the print didn’t move around anymore – she hadn’t told me the print moved because she didn’t know it could be any different – it had always been like that.
I conduct most programmes in my home but have been welcomed into local schools to provide follow-up and continuity for existing clients. I will also give a programme in the client’s home or workplace to accommodate their needs.
